The Challenge Ahead
The upcoming 119th Congress presents a significant challenge to the renewable energy sector. Efforts are underway by some Republican members of the House to repeal clean energy incentives included in the Inflation Reduction Act. Additionally, the President-Elect has expressed intentions to target these incentives, putting at risk the progress we’ve made in advancing clean energy technologies.
This political landscape requires us to be proactive. The potential repeal of these incentives isn’t just a legislative issue; it’s an economic and environmental concern that could impact millions of jobs, energy costs, and America’s position as a leader in renewable energy innovation.
Why We Must Act Now
- Job Creation and Economic Growth
- Solar Leads in Job Creation: Solar energy creates 1.8 jobs for every $1 million invested, more than twice as many as the next closest technology.
- Economic Impact: Over 270,000 Americans are employed in the solar industry, contributing significantly to local economies across the nation.
- Energy Independence and Security
- Domestic Energy Production: Investing in renewable energy reduces dependence on foreign oil, enhancing national security.
- Reliability and Stability: Solar and storage solutions add resilience to the grid, mitigating the impact of extreme weather events and ensuring consistent energy supply.
- Bipartisan Support and Historical Success
- Maintaining the Status Quo: We’re asking lawmakers to preserve existing incentives, allowing the industry to continue its growth trajectory without seeking new or expanded tax credits.
- Opportunity for Credit: This approach enables all members of Congress to take pride in the industry’s success and the benefits it brings to their constituencies.
- Meeting Increasing Energy Demand
- Rising Energy Needs: The Federal Energy Regulatory Commission (FERC) projects an 81% increase in energy demand from 2023 to 2024.
- Rapid Deployment: Solar and storage technologies are uniquely positioned to meet this surge efficiently and sustainably.
- Manufacturing and Global Competitiveness
- Domestic Manufacturing Boom: With 64 new factories online and 44 under construction, the renewable energy sector is a powerhouse of manufacturing growth.
- Global Leadership: Maintaining incentives ensures the U.S. remains competitive, fostering innovation and technological advancement.
Effective Engagement with Republican Members of Congress
To build bipartisan support for clean energy tax credits, we must engage effectively with Republican members of Congress. Here’s how:
- Emphasize Economic Benefits
- Job Creation: Highlight that solar creates 1.8 jobs per $1 million invested.
- Local Impact: Provide data on jobs and investments in their specific districts or states.
- Focus on Reliability and Stability
- Grid Resilience: Share examples of how solar and storage have mitigated reliability issues during extreme weather events.
- Energy Independence: Frame renewable energy as a means to achieve national security goals.
- Maintain the Status Quo
- No New Requests: Stress that we’re not asking for new or expanded tax credits, but to preserve the existing ones.
- Shared Success: Encourage them to take credit for the industry’s growth and the benefits to their constituents.
- Leverage Local Connections
- Community Ties: Engage local businesses and stakeholders who can attest to the benefits of clean energy incentives.
- Customized Messaging: Tailor discussions to address the specific needs and interests of their communities.
- Coordinate and Collaborate
- Unified Voice: Work closely with industry associations like SEIA to align messaging.
- Share Intelligence: Participate in weekly campaign calls to stay informed and adjust strategies as needed.
